A pedestrian has died in hospital after a car with an uninsured driver behind the wheel struck him at the intersection of Argyle and Marsden streets, Parramatta, on Monday September 14.
The 55-year-old man died in hospital this morning.
Just after 3.30pm on September 14, emergency services were called to the intersection following reports a Toyota sedan struck the man.
The pedestrian was treated at the scene for head injuries, before being taken to Westmead Hospital.
The 34-year-old driver was uninjured and taken to hospital for mandatory testing.
Parramatta police started an investigation into the circumstances surrounding the crash.
Police will prepare a report for the Coroner.
